Are Gateron clear switches quiet?

Instead of being a heavy tactile, the Gateron Clear is a super-light linear switch.
...
The Main Line-Up.

COLOR Clear
TYPE Linear
OPERATING FORCE 35cN
ACTIVATION POINT 2mm
NOISE LEVEL Low

Are Gateron switches scratchy?

Some brands of mechanical switches start off more scratchy than others. ... It's feels almost as though there is sand between the stem and the switch housing. Gateron switches tend to have a better reputation because their switch stem is slightly smaller, reducing the amount of friction between the sliders and the housing.
